Sourcing miscellaneous marine supplies—ranging from specialized deck hardware and rigging components to maintenance accessories—requires navigating a highly fragmented manufacturing base. The primary challenge for volume buyers is maintaining strict material and performance standards across a diverse catalog. A factory that excels in injection-molding UV-stabilized plastics rarely possesses the metallurgy expertise required for high-load stainless steel casting. Building a reliable catalog means identifying and coordinating with specialized facilities for each material type.

Defining "Marine-Grade" Material Specifications

The marine environment is notoriously unforgiving. When sourcing supplies, generic material specifications will lead to rapid field failures, warranty claims, and brand damage. You must specify exact alloys and polymer grades on your purchase orders, and verify them before shipment.

For metal components, corrosion resistance and tensile strength are the primary drivers of cost and quality.

MaterialCorrosion ResistanceTypical Marine Application
304 Stainless SteelModerate (susceptible to chloride pitting)Freshwater environments, interior cabin hardware
316 Stainless SteelHigh (contains molybdenum for chloride resistance)Saltwater deck hardware, underwater fittings, rigging
Marine Bronze (Gunmetal)Excellent (forms protective patina)Thru-hull fittings, heavy-duty structural components
Anodized AluminumGood (requires intact anodic coating)Bimini frames, lightweight structural supports

For plastics and composites, UV degradation and embrittlement are the main threats. Ensure your suppliers are using UV-stabilized polymers (like ASA or specialized nylon blends) rather than standard ABS, which will yellow and crack after a single season of sun exposure.

Manufacturing Processes and Quality Control

The manufacturing method dictates both the unit cost and the structural integrity of the marine supply. For complex stainless steel hardware (like cleats, hinges, or shackles), investment casting (lost-wax casting) is the industry standard. It provides excellent dimensional accuracy and a smooth surface finish that minimizes microscopic pits where rust can form.

However, casting defects like porosity or inclusions can severely compromise load-bearing capacity. Implementing rigorous Quality Control & Inspection is non-negotiable.

Essential QC Checks for Marine Supplies

  • Positive Material Identification (PMI): Use handheld XRF spectrometers to verify 316 stainless steel composition (specifically checking for 2-3% molybdenum).
  • Salt Spray Testing: Verify corrosion resistance via ASTM B117 standards (typically demanding 500+ hours without red rust for saltwater gear).
  • Load and Tensile Testing: Destructive testing for critical load-bearing hardware to ensure it meets stated working load limits (WLL).
  • UV Exposure Testing: ASTM G154 accelerated weathering tests for plastics and textiles to verify colorfastness and structural retention.

If you are developing proprietary hardware or modifying existing designs, partnering with factories that offer robust OEM/ODM Services is crucial. They can assist with CAD refinement, mold flow analysis, and rapid prototyping before you commit to expensive steel tooling.

Sourcing Mechanics: MOQs, Lead Times, and Pricing

Because "Other Marine Supplies" encompasses everything from small injection-molded clips to heavy cast-metal assemblies, procurement metrics vary widely. Tooling costs are often the largest upfront barrier when moving away from off-the-shelf factory designs.

Pricing is heavily indexed to global commodity markets, particularly nickel and molybdenum for stainless steel, and crude oil for plastics. When negotiating long-term contracts, experienced buyers often tie their pricing agreements to these raw material indices to ensure fair adjustments over time.
